Deputy Nursery Manager

Watford
money-bag £32000 - £34000/annum salary is negotiable

We are currently looking for a DEPUTY MANAGER to help run our beautiful, children’s day nursery and pre-school in Watford.

We are looking or someone with great leadership skills, who’s committed to early years childcare, with experience managing a team within a nursery, preschool or childcare environment.

What we offer:

We value our dedicated and hard working staff and offer ongoing support and training, great opportunities, as well as above market rates of pay, holiday allowances and a range of other benefits!

We realise the importance of having a good work life balance and offer a 4 day working week with compressed hours with 1 set day off. Alternatively 5 day working week is also an option.

Main duties and responsibilities of the Deputy Manager:

You will be supporting the daily running within the nursery, supporting the room leaders with training, paperwork. You will be part room part office based.

  • To assist the nursery managers in the day to day running of the setting.

  • To support the nursery staff and to ensure that they comply at all times with all policies, procedures and standards, including health and safety, hygiene, inclusion and confidentiality.

  • To lead the planning of safe, creative and appropriate opportunities according to children’s needs and interests to fulfil the requirements of the EYFS.

  • To develop and maintain good relationships and communication with parents/carers to facilitate meeting the needs of each child, including organising meetings to update and involve parent/carers in their child’s learning.

  • To help supervise and contribute to performance management of staff according to policies and procedure’s.

  • Working creatively with children within the EY framework, in order to provide an enabling learning environment for all children.

  • Ensuring all children have equal access to opportunities to learn and develop.

The ideal candidate will:

  • Must have proven experience of managing within a childcare setting, (1+years) of deputy experience or Third in charge is ideal.

  • Must hold a relevant Early Years qualification equivalent to Level 3 or above.

  • Experience of working with the Early Years Foundation Stages.

  • Understanding and recognition of the principles of equality and diversity.

  • Proven and successful experience of working with children of relevant age in an early learning environment.

  • Ability to lead the effective planning of learning.

  • Ability to set, demonstrate and promote good practice in line with the ethos of the Nursery

  • Experience of having kept written records of children’s achievements including observations.

  • Excellent communications skills.
